THE APPLICATION OF ULTRAFILTRATION IN ASH CONTENT DECREMENT OF BLACK LIQUOR FROM ASPEN ALKALINE SULFITE PULPING PROCESS

扫码查看
In this paper, the ultrafiltration (UF) is applied to decrease the inorganic ash content of black liquor from aspen alkaline sodium sulfite anthraquinone (ASAQ) pulping process。 Some parameters which may affect the efficiency of ash content decrement in black liquor were investigated, such as the molecular weight cut-off of the ultrafiltration membrane, the solids content of black liquor, operating pressure and the percentage of the filtered liquor volume。 The results show that the inorganic permeation rate increases and ash content decreases with the increase of the operating pressure; the effect of membrane molecular weight on ash content decrement is not obvious。 The inorganic ash content in the ultrafiltrated black liquor decreases to 23。8% (or decreases by 7。5 percents) and the lignin cutoff rate is 70。87% when the optimized conditions are as follows: the molecular weight cut-off 10000, the percentage of permeation filtrate volume 60%, black liquor solids content 10% and operating pressure 0。25 MPa。
